Queer Books and What I Think Of Them (Part 1?)
Hello! I wanted to talk about books, so I wrote this up. I hope you enjoy :)
Simon Vs The Homosapiens Agenda By Becky Albertalli
It was the first queer book that I ever owned. I read the entire thing in 6 hours on the day that I got it. It has gay and bi rep and has a mlm romance at the center of the story. Also, it’s quite better than the movie, in my opinon.
Leah On The Off Beat By Becky Albertalli
It’s the sequel to Simon Vs, taking place a while after the first book. I also read this book in 6 hours on the day I got it. It centers around a bi wlw relationship with a background mlm relationship. I really liked it, just as much as I liked Simon.
The Song Of Achilles By Madeline Miller
One of my favorite books! It’s a retelling of The Illiad, told through the perspective of Patroclus! It centers around a mlm relationship that I can only describe as intensely requited love. I highly recommend it, but it includes the fallowing: major character death, war, sexual assault, loose descriptions of sex, and kidnapping.Also, it’s nearly 400 pages.
Aristotle and Dante Discover The Secrets Of The Universe By Benjamin Alire Sáenz
I don’t really remember this book, to be perfectly honest. If I recall correctly, it takes place in the 70s or 80s in a rather small town, has poc rep, and the ending includes mentions of transphobia. I do remember that it centers on a mlm relationship that I’m pretty sure was quite the mess, the book takes place over a year, and the book is about 350 pages. I don’t feel like I can recommend this book until I give it a reread.
The Last To Let Go By Amber Smith
The first wlw book on this list! It centers on a young woman named Brooke and her family. Over the course of the story, she ends up realizing that she’s a lesbian, but it isn’t the main focus of the story. As for the main story, it includes the death of a parent, domestic abuse, murder, funerals, and generally characters learning to work through and live with trauma. There’s also a fade-to-black sex scene if I remember correctly. I don’t remember there being any poc rep, there’s two lesbians and one gay man, and there’s a mute character. The book is 363 pages long. I recommend it if you want a book about coping and living with trauma but if you just want a soft lesbian romance, this isn’t the book for you.
Lumberjanes By Noelle Stevenson
If you do want a soft lesbian romance, here you go! Lumberjames is a comic series by the lovely Noelle Stevenson. It centers around a group of girls who are in a group that’s alot like Girl Scouts as they try to earn badges and learn about the magical things in the woods surrounding them. It includes a soft wlw romance, poc rep and a transgender girl in the main cast. I’ve only read two volumes of the comic so far, but I highly recommend it!
